GEM Production at the FTD in Bonn
arXiv:2606.03295v1 Announce Type: new Abstract: This manuscript describes the establishment of a local production line for 10 cm x 10 cm Gas Electron Multiplier (GEM) foils at the Forschungs- und Technologiezentrum Detektorphysik (FTD) at the university of Bonn. GEM foils are widely used in modern gaseous detectors, providing high-gain signal amplification and high-rate capability.

Your kitchen sponge is releasing microplastics every time you wash dishes
Your kitchen sponge is releasing microplastics every time you wash dishes - Date: - June 1, 2026 - Source: - University of Bonn - Summary: - Kitchen sponges release microplastics as they wear down during everyday use, with some sponge types shedding far more than others. Researchers estimated that millions of households could collectively release hundreds of tons of microplastics annually.
